    I have a Volkswagon Scirocco R Line 2.0 Diesel, the problem i have is the im not getting heat from the heating system its always cold to luke warm, the air conditioning is working perfectly, the pipes are hot going into the back of the dashboard. Would it be the small radiator beside the dashboard or is it some sort of a sensor that goes faulty in them?
    I changed the thermostat OEM thinking it would solve the problem but it didn't.

    May be similar, but I have a mk3 leon 2.0 tdi 184 , and I started losing some coolant in, looking at stuff on the Internet obvious suggestions were head going porous, gasket failure, etc, also what came up was people on about cold heaters and seems there was trouble with the heater element blocking on them, can't remember how exactly, but think they internally failed, and may have had a recall.
    My coolant loss was due to the dpf regeneration, got so hot that it boils the coolant off. Dpf solution instigated along with a remap sorted it, luckily not hgf.

    Just had quick look on net and reminded of something like a silicone bag in header tank splitting and it collected in the element blocking it, apparently mk7 golfs suffer too.
